A kind of Moisture-proof switch cabinet
Technical field
The utility model relate to distribution industry field more particularly to a kind of Moisture-proof switch cabinet.
Background technique
Switchgear is the final stage device of distribution system, and switchgear is used in the occasion that load is more dispersed, circuit is less, it The electric energy of a certain circuit of upper level controller switching equipment is distributed to nearest load.Due to many performances of switchgear, it is determined Importance.Switchgear can generate a large amount of heat needs, it is therefore desirable on power distribution cabinet due to the work of internal electric appliance original part Heat release hole is set, and when power distribution cabinet is in a humid environment in use, the aqueous vapor in wet environment is easily accessible in cabinet body, cause It is moist in switchgear, it influences normally to work, especially when the plum rains time, weather is very moist, for a long time moist meeting Lead to ageing equipment in cabinet body, dielectric strength reduction, secondary terminals breakdown, material mildew and steel construction piece corrosion, To cause safety accident.

As shown in Figure 1 to Figure 3, the utility model embodiment includes:
A kind of Moisture-proof switch cabinet further includes setting including cabinet body 1 and multiple cabinet doors 2 for being sealingly disposed in 1 front end of cabinet body Dehumidification device 3 in 1 side of cabinet body.As shown in Figures 2 and 3, the dehumidification device 3 includes shell 31, mounting base 32, fan 33, dehumidify air duct 34, condenser 35, moisture absorption block 36 and aqueduct 37, and the mounting base 32 is separately positioned on the outer of shell 31 Side, the fan 33 are arranged in the front of shell 31 and are connected with the dehumidifying air duct 34 inside shell 31, the suction The inlet in dehumidifying air duct 34 is set for wet piece 36, and the aqueduct 37 is mounted on the exit in dehumidifying air duct 34, described The setting of condenser 35 is in 34 inside of dehumidifying air duct and between moisture absorption block 36 and aqueduct 37.
Among the above, the Moisture-proof switch cabinet further includes catch basin 4, the aqueduct of the catch basin 4 and dehumidification device 3 37 are connected, with the water being discharged in collection aqueduct 37.
Further, the moisture absorption block 37 is using drying made by silicon and the crystalline microporous material of aluminium oxide synthesis Agent, is a kind of molecular sieve structure, molecular sieve by physical attraction by Molecular Adsorption on the surface area of crystal.Due to molecular sieve The 95% of surface area is located in aperture, needs to screen the size of neighboring molecule by screening, and only small molecule could pass through crystalline substance The aperture openings of body enter the interior adsorption plane of molecular sieve, and this selectable adsorption phenomena is referred to as molecular sieving effect.
Moisture is condensed into water after moisture absorption block 37 adsorbs the moisture in cabinet body 1, then by condenser, to pass through aqueduct Extra water is discharged.
Wherein, the dehumidifying air duct 34 uses front wide and rear narrow funnel type structure, and moisture absorption is good, and discharge is facilitated to condense Water afterwards.
The humid air of confined space is actively sucked to dehumidifying air duct 34, the steam warp in air under the action of fan 33 It is condensed into water after crossing condenser 35, then cabinet body is discharged by aqueduct, can achieve good effect on moisture extraction.By lowering air Middle water content simultaneously declines relative humidity and humidity, hardly raising temperature, does not generate the negative effect of temperature difference bring, from Fundamentally prevent or reduce the generation of accident, the aging of device and cabinet body in cabinet will not be accelerated because of high temperature.
In the present embodiment, the dehumidification device 3 is mounted on a side or the two sides of cabinet body 1.Wherein, the cabinet body 1 top is additionally provided with radiator 5, helps switchgear to radiate, extends the service life of switchgear.
